Use the equation. How much SiCl4 is needed to produce 2.7 moles HCl?
SiCl4 + 4 H2O --> H4SiO4 + 4 HCl

4 moles of HCl are produced by 1 mole of SiCl4

2.7 moles of HCl will be produced if we have

2.7/4=0.675moles of SiCl4

molecular weight of SiCl4 =169.9g

amount of SiCl4 needed = 169.9 X 0.675=114.682g

114.682 g is the answer
